DESCRIPTION:The city of Westlake has scheduled its summer concerts offeri
 ng a wide variety of family entertainment including award-winning perfor
 mers every Sunday evening now through August 12. The free concerts are s
 taged at the Westlake Recreation Center&rsquo\;s pavilion. There is plen
 ty of parking available and patrons should bring a lawn chair or blanket
  to enjoy a Sunday summer evening of music.\nHere's the schedule of conc
 erts:\nJuly 8: Haywire.&nbsp\;This Rockabilly/Roots Rock band has a fres
 h\, fun and smoothly rocking style. Haywire has a sound all its own but 
 with a little Buddy Holly\, Carl Perkins\, Duane Eddy and Johnny Cash. S
 ome of the music may be their own creations and has even been compared t
 o what Elvis Presley might have recorded.\nJuly 15: Logan Wells and Jere
 my Colosimo.&nbsp\;Logan has performed professionally for over 18 years 
 and has shared the stage with many great artists. Logan headlined at the
  Las Vegas Hilton main showroom and later at Mandalay Bay during the CMA
  awards in 2004. She performed in Westlake for President George W. Bush&
 rsquo\;s campaign and later for First Lady Laura Bush. Jerry has been en
 tertaining audiences in the Northern Ohio area for over 20 years with a 
 wide range of genres. Musical styles include Frank Sinatra\, PatsyCline\
 , Neil Diamond\, Stevie Nicks\, The Temptations\, Aretha Franklin\, Kare
 n Carpenter and many others.\nJuly 22: Sloppy Joe Band.&nbsp\;This Cleve
 land band performs a wide selection of great Classic Rock\, Pop and Blue
 s from the 60&rsquo\;s\, 70&rsquo\;s and 80&rsquo\;s. Sloppy by NO means
 \, this band covers everything from the Allman Brothers to ZZTop. Sloppy
  Joe is a fun band who plays great music from great artists.\nJuly 29: B
 lue Lunch.&nbsp\;Cleveland&rsquo\;s own Blue Lunch Swing Dance Band deli
 vers their own sound with an eclectic flavor\, playing 1950&rsquo\;s swi
 ng and jump blues\, along with Chicago-Style blues and New Orleans R&amp
 \;B. Blue Lunch has performed at the Rock &amp\; Roll Hall of Fame and M
 useum\, at Severance Hall and the OhioState Fair. They have opened shows
  for The Beach Boys\, Big Bad Voodoo Daddy and many other artists.\nAugu
 st 5: Mo' Mojo.&nbsp\;This band specializes in live shows that kick. The
 y take the best of Zydeco and the best of theJam Band spirit. What is Zy
 deco music? It&rsquo\;s good old foot-stompin&rsquo\; dance music that o
 riginatedin the French-speaking Creole culture of southern Louisiana\, f
 eaturing a unique blend of musicalinfluences from blues and soul\, Afro-
 Caribbean\, and traditional Cajun music. Mo&rsquo\; Mojo combines French
 -style accordion\, driving danceable drum beats\, rock solid bass guitar
 \, blazing electric guitar\,and of course the entertaining rubboard\, or
  frottoir (as it&rsquo\;s called by the Cajuns) to create the recipefor 
 &ldquo\;Music You Just Can&rsquo\;t Take Sittin&rsquo\; Down.&rdquo\;\nA
 ugust 12: Colin Dussault's Blues Project.&nbsp\;The Project can best be 
 described as an award-winning harmonica driven\, blues based\, roots\, r
 ock and soul music. The Project can include original music as well as bl
 ues\, rock\, country\, jazz\, swing\,folk\, reggae\, Motown and even the
  occasional polka. Lead singer\, Colin Dussault&rsquo\;s Blues Project h
 as played literally thousands of shows. One reviewer called Colin &ldquo
 \;the hardest working blues manin Cleveland.&rdquo\; The Project has sha
 red the stage with such luminaries as Bo Diddley\, The FabulousThunderbi
 rds\, Blood Sweat &amp\; Tears\, Eric Burdon and many more. They have pl
 ayed every venue including a fund raiser for First Lady Hillary Rodham C
 linton.
